I trimmed Distress Watercolor card to 3" x 6", stamped the Outline Ornaments inked with Black Soot Distress Archival ink, sprinkled with Simon Says Clear Fine Detail Embossing Powder and heat set.
I sprayed the panel with Winterberry and Frosted Juniper Distress Mica Stains, dried, spritzed lightly with water and dried again. I used a wet paintbrush to remove colour from the highlight areas of the baubles, spritzed Flickering Candlelight Distress Mica Stain on to my glass Media Mat, painted the ornament hangers and added some splatters.
I die-cut the shadow from Simon Says Black cardstock, the word 3 times from Distress Watercolor card using Simon Says Believe Wafer Thin die, layered to create dimension and fixed in place with Distress Collage Medium. I fixed the panel to Simon Says White cardstock trimmed to leave a small border and fixed to a black cardstock, scored and folded to create a Mini Slimline card.
I stamped the sentiment from the co-ordinating Simon Says Believe stamp set inked with Simon Says Embossing ink on to a scrap of black cardstock, sprinkled with Simon Says White Fine Detail Embossing Powder, heat set, trimmed and fixed to the panel with Distress Collage Medium Matte.
The camera certainly doesn't show the gorgeous shimmer and sparkle from the Distress Mica Stains as you turn the card in the light and in my humble opinion, you can never have enough sparkle on a Christmas card so I added gorgeous pink-toned irridescent sequins from Sizzix.
